Evapotranspiration and Reasonable Irrigation Amount of Four Ornamental Grasses in Beijing

Abstract: To evaluate the water requirement of perennial ornamental grasses in Beijing,the evapotranspiration of one2 year2old Arundinella hirta, Stipa tenuissima, Calamagrostis brachytricha and Festuca glauca was measured in mini2lysime2 ters fromJune to October in 2006,based on evapotranspiration feedback irrigation. The evapotranspiration between different ornamental grasses differed significantly in every month except October. The evapotranspiration of the same ornamental grass in different months differed significantly except Festuca glauca. The total evapotranspiration of Arundinella tenuissima, Sti2 pa bungeana, Calamagrostis brachytricha and Festuca glauca was respectively 812184,642126,524102 and 333149 mm. The highest evapatranspiration of warm2season Arundinella hirta and Calamagrostis brachytricha showed in Semptember,and which of cold2season Stipa tenuissima and Festuca glauca was in July. Combined with the fact rain fall in 2006,irrigation was necessary fromJuly to October for Arundinella hirta and Stipa tenuissima,and from September to October for Calama2 grostis brachytricha and Festuca glauca. The reasonable irrigation amount was respectively 440180,268145,267109 and 108102 mm.By means of Penman2Monteith equation,crop coefficients of Arundinella hirta, Stipa tenuissima, Calamagrostis brachytricha and Festuca glauca fromJune to October were respectively 0163 — 2115,0164 — 1184,0138 — 1146 and 0156 — 0177.Based on the evaporation of evaporation pan,the water requirement coefficientsof Arundinella hirta, Stipa tenuissima, Calamagrostis brachytricha and Festuca glauca from June to October were respectively 1102 — 3140,0194 — 2147,0161 — 2131 and 0189 — 0198. The factors influencing irrigation amount evaluation were discussed.
